No matter how long you’ve been a smoker for, as soon as you stop, your lungs will begin to heal themselves. Within eight hours, nicotine will have mostly left your system. Within forty-eight hours, your sense of smell and taste will begin to return. Within two weeks, your cardiovascular health will have significantly improved and you will find yourself being able to run and go up the stairs much more easily. After one year, your risk of heart disease will be halved. The2016black-woman-e-cig benefits of quitting on your health will just keep adding up each year.

Pick a day

Quitting requires both mental and physical preparation. Mark a date on the calendar that is less than a month away and get yourself mentally ready to quit in the weeks leading to the day. Be happy! It’s an exciting time; you are looking towards healthier days and a better version of yourself. Stock up on healthy snacks such as nuts and carrot sticks, as well as sugar-free gum to curb the cravings.

The day before your chosen date, throw away all your cigarettes and get rid of your ashtrays, matches, lighters and anything else related to cigarette smoking. Remember that you will wake up a non-smoker, so you won’t be needing those any longer.

Pick a method

Several quit-smoking aids are available to you. They range from behavioral or nicotine replacement therapy, to medicine or going completely cold turkey. The method you choose is entirely up to you, but it should be the one that you feel you are most likely to be able to stick with.

An electronic cigarette, or e-cig, consists of a battery-operated device that vaporizes flavored liquids containing various doses of nicotine, or none at all. The liquids are made of water, nicotine, flavoring, glycerin and propylene glycol. E-cigarettes come in various flavors, from classic tobacco, to mint, to more fruity and sweet flavors. They also come in nicotine dosages ranging from 0mg to 20mg. Initially, you should choose a liquid that has a similar nicotine dosage to the cigarettes you are smoking. This will leave time for your brain to accept the replacement while not crave the nicotine. Once you are comfortable with the shift, start to progressively lower the nicotine dosage of your e-cig. When the weaning is complete, use nicotine-free e-juice for a few weeks before giving up vaping completely.

Don’t get discouraged!

If there are any bumps in the road on your journey to quitting, don’t panic. A relapse doesn’t mean that you’ve failed! Maybe you’ve smoked one or two cigarettes, but it happens. First, keep calm. Look back and realize how far you’ve come, how much money you’ve saved and how much better you feel. Relapses are a normal part of the process and are very common. Try to understand why it happened and see if you can avoid repeating the same pattern again. Don’t give up!
